Federal judge blocked NXST Nexstar Media's Tegna takeover issuing preliminary injunction. The broadcaster halted integration plans as antitrust lawsuit delayed merger. CVBF CVB Financial completed Heritage Commerce acquisition showing regional bank consolidation momentum.
FT reported Europe embracing mega M&A as the EU plans biggest relaxation of corporate merger rules in decades. LYV Live Nation inked $742M in private debt tied to venues per Bloomberg.

Wall Street banks launched derivatives trading on private credit funds. JPMorgan and Barclays offer CDS on Apollo, Ares and Blackstone per FT reporting as scrutiny of alternative lending intensified.
